3D Printing in Oral Surgery

Here are four essential methods which 3D printing is shaping the field:

- ** Personalized Surgical Guides **: 3D printing permits the production of very precise and patient-specific medical overviews, enhancing the accuracy and performance of procedures.

- ** Implant Prosthetics **: With 3D printing, oral specialists can develop tailored implant prosthetics that perfectly fit a patient's one-of-a-kind makeup, causing far better results and client complete satisfaction.

- ** Bone Grafting **: 3D printing enables the production of patient-specific bone grafts, decreasing the demand for standard implanting techniques and enhancing healing and recovery time.

- ** Education and Educating **: 3D printing can be made use of to develop practical medical models for instructional functions, permitting oral doctors to practice complex treatments before executing them on clients.

With its possible to improve precision, modification, and training, 3D printing is an interesting growth in the field of oral surgery.

Minimally Intrusive Strategies



To additionally progress the field of dental surgery, welcome the capacity of minimally invasive strategies that can substantially profit both surgeons and people alike.

Minimally invasive methods are transforming the area by decreasing surgical injury, minimizing post-operative pain, and increasing the healing process. These methods entail using smaller sized cuts and specialized tools to perform procedures with accuracy and efficiency.

By making use of innovative imaging modern technology, such as cone beam of light calculated tomography (CBCT), cosmetic surgeons can accurately intend and perform surgeries with very little invasiveness.

In addition, making use of lasers in dental surgery permits accurate tissue cutting and coagulation, leading to minimized blood loss and lowered recovery time.

With minimally invasive techniques, individuals can experience much faster recuperation, lowered scarring, and enhanced outcomes, making it a crucial facet of the future of dental surgery.
